How do I get a mid level provost job?

Position yourself around demonstrated ownership of academic programs, curriculum oversight, or faculty coordination rather than just participation. Highlight projects where you set direction, resolved institutional challenges, or collaborated across departments. Applications that show measurable outcomes, such as improved retention rates or successful accreditation cycles, stand out. Tailor your materials to the specific institution type and underscore your ability to work with limited supervision.

How do I move up to a mid level provost role?

Moving into a mid level provost role typically requires building depth in academic program management, faculty relations, or accreditation processes over your early career years. Taking on progressively larger projects, owning outcomes rather than just executing tasks, and demonstrating measurable impact on student success or institutional performance are the signals hiring committees look for when evaluating candidates for mid level academic leadership.
